Abstract
Coupled Dokshitzer-Gribov-Lipatov-Altarelli-Parisi equations involving singlet quark and gluon distributions are explored by a Taylor expansion at small xas two first-order partial differential equations in two variables: Bjorken xand t(t=ln\frac{{Q}^{2}}{{\mathrm{\ensuremath{\Lambda}}}^{2}}. The system of equations are then solved by Lagrange's method and the method of characteristics. We obtain the proton structure function...
